LLC or S-corp? The decision, without the mystique.

One number tells you the answer. Everything else is noise the internet added.

The number is your net business profit. Below roughly $60–80K, the S-corp election typically costs more in payroll, bookkeeping, and complexity than it saves in self-employment tax. Above that, it usually starts to pay for itself.

Everything else — liability, branding, professional feel — is a separate question and mostly handled by the LLC itself, not the tax election on top of it.
